Output 84a8811fb9a9dfd4380bd067e3faae09c4f0de1abce61e2df26a0691cb4cff31:1

value
687152580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3b2df103e97d38dee4a388b581b1db2d5cd0d3 OP_EQUAL
address
2MupVoWtPApSvuufHkSbT9haE2jsGp9hwRD
transaction
84a8811fb9a9dfd4380bd067e3faae09c4f0de1abce61e2df26a0691cb4cff31